Aldous Huxley Quotes
It Is The Unco-ordinated Activity Of Large-scale Production That Leads To Those Periodical Crises And Depressions Which Inflict Such Untold Hardship Upon The Working Masses Of The People In Industrialized Countries. Small-scale Production Carried On By Individuals Who Own The Instruments With Which They Personally Work Is Not Subject To Periodical Slumps. Furthermore, The Ownership Of The Means Of Small-scale, Personal Production Has None Of The Disastrous Political, Economic And Psychological Consequences Of Large-scale Production-loss Of Independence, Enslavement To An Employer, Insecurity Of The Tenure Of Employment.
